Omaha Community Playhouse Presents Reading of WORKING

By: Nov. 01, 2016

A staged reading of Working will be held at the Omaha Community Playhouse as part of the Alternative Programming series Monday, November 14 at 7:30 p.m. in OCP's Howard Drew Theatre. The showing is free and open to the public with the opportunity for donation. No tickets or reservations are necessary.

Working is a musical that paints a vivid portrait of the men and women that the world so often takes for granted - the working class. Featuring music by several musical theatre and popular music composers, this musical is an exploration of 26 people from all walks of life. Appropriate for all Audiences.
